Output 7740681c6223a6eb8f97c00a4c90a84d657feb25e249a311c0e7bb450f69792d:105

value
70587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b238a9262d4225dd8e40dc1845b52a03ba8023 OP_EQUAL
address
37b6frc4tjq6prz1CT8yadWGN9q3Y2sBdn
transaction
7740681c6223a6eb8f97c00a4c90a84d657feb25e249a311c0e7bb450f69792d
spent
true